The opening Bellano leg of the H22 Aon Cup 2025 came to a close with a full slate of six races. Even better news came in the form of record participation, making this the best-attended event of the year so far. The racing was tight throughout, with a mix of new crews and familiar faces adding to the competitive flair.
After a short wait on Saturday afternoon, a nice Breva breeze arrived, allowing the Race Committee to get three races underway. At the end of the day, it was the Valli family on ITA 112 (1-3-6) leading the standings. In second place was a promising new team, helmed by Federico Maccari on ITA 136 (6-2-3), making an impressive debut in the H22 class. Rounding out the provisional podium was Matteo Nasini on ITA 202 (2-1-12), who suffered a costly finish in the third race but started strong with top results in the first two.
Sunday brought three more races, with a few shifts in the standings. Despite a challenging opening race, the Valli team on ITA 112 responded in style, finishing the day with a first and another first ((6)-1-1), cementing their spot at the top. Meanwhile, Matteo Nasini and ITA 202 surged back to claim second overall, thanks to three solid finishes (3-2-5). In third place came Federico Maccari and ITA 136 (2-3-3), who delivered a remarkably competitive performance in their first H22 outing.
